Why Opt Laser Dentistry for Wisdom Teeth Removal?

In the traditional wisdom tooth extraction method, a scalpel and stitches are used and the healing process lasts longer. Laser Dentistry puts an end to that. With the laser, dentist can remove gum tissue with concentrated light energy and sanitize the area, helping them to extract teeth without damaging surrounding tissue.

Key benefits include-

  • Less Pain and Discomfort: Lasers seal nerve endings during the process and minimize pain after the procedure, which means less need for heavy anesthetics.
  • Minimal Bleeding: The laser cauterizes while cutting which means considerably less bleeding.
  • Reduced Infection Risk: The laser's energy efficiently sterilizes the treatment area, killing all the bacteria, without exception.
  • Faster Healing Time: There would be less trauma to the gums and bone, and patients usually heal within days of the procedure.

The Procedure: How Laser Dentistry Works for Wisdom Teeth

Upon entering an Oxnard dental clinic for laser wisdom teeth extraction, your dentist will immediately perform a thorough examination and make digital X-rays. This is very important in order to correctly determine the position of your wisdom teeth.

Step-by-step process-

  • When preparing, the dentist will numb the area with local anesthesia. Patients that are anxious may choose to be sedated.
  • Laser Gum Opening: Extremely precise laser is used to gently open the gum tissue above the tooth.
  • Tooth Removal: The dentist is careful to remove the tooth, making it a better experience.
  • Site Sterilization: The laser is then re-used to sterilize and seal the tissue.
  • Final Step: Depending on the case, stitches may not be necessary.

This new procedure is more efficient and allows for much more comfortable recovery.

Aftercare and Recovery

Although laser dentistry shortens the healing time, adequate aftercare remains crucial for optimal outcomes.

Post-procedure tips-

  • Use a cold compress to help decrease swelling during the first day.
  • Eat soft foods like yogurt, mashed potatoes, and smoothies for the first two days.
  • Avoid hot or spicy foods that could irritate the site.
  • Rinse gently with warm salt water after 24 hours to keep the area clean.
